| |DECEMBER 202419Strengthening StandardsUnlike others, BRF provides a truly end-to-end solution within a single, unified facility. Spanning over 1.5 lakh square feet, the lab houses more than 500+ state-of-the-art instruments, multiple clean rooms, and a team of around 300+ highly trained professionals, all well-versed in regulatory aspects and GLP standards. The centralized approach allows the company to cover everything from basic physical and chemical analysis to complex studies like radiology, pathology, biochemistry, toxicology, genotoxicology, and pharmacology--all within the same facility.The comprehensive range of services offered ensures that manufacturers can rely on the facility to manage every aspect of their testing needs, maintaining consistency and quality control throughout the process. Having generated over 15,000 GLP reports for more than 300 clients worldwide, the facility has established a strong reputation for reliability. These reports, recognized and accepted by regulatory agencies globally, enhance confidence in the product's ability to pass scrutiny without significant issues. In the event of regulatory questions, the facility provides extensive support, including 10 years of archival services by GLP norms, ensuring that manufacturers can return for assistance at any time.Chemistry forms the backbone of any preclinical CRO and BRF's chemistry department stands as one of the largest in the company, with over 50 experts and an impressive array of advanced equipment, including more than 40 HPLCs, multiple top-of-the-line LC-MS, HRMS, GCMS, and NMR systems. The extensive suite of chemistry services supports standalone projects and other departments, particularly as regulatory norms, including GLP, demand rigorous chemistry data for everything from dosing animal models to conducting field studies on agrochemicals. As biosimilars and bioanalytical services become increasingly crucial, the company remains one of the few labs in India offering comprehensive GLP-compliant chemistry services, bolstered by a highly qualified team and cutting-edge instruments, ensuring clients receive timely, accurate reports. Recognizing a critical bottleneck in the availability of quality reference standards, BRF is planning a state-of-the-art facility dedicated to synthetic chemistry services. While this facility is in development, the company is already addressing client needs through in-house preparatory HPLCs, flash chromatography, and other purification equipment, ensuring that testing timelines and costs are effectively managed.By investing in the latest technology and staying at the forefront of innovation, the company can offer its clients cutting-edge solutions that meet their needs in a timely and cost-effective manner. For example, it has been one of the leaders in adopting rapid microbiological methods (RMMs), which offer faster results without compromising accuracy. These methods are particularly valuable in today's fast-paced industry, where time is often of the essence.The facility is committed to continuous investment and innovation, driven by an unwavering dedication to upgrading and expanding its capabilities. The emphasis is on acquiring the most advanced equipment and ensuring that every aspect of the facility remains state-of-the-art. This commitment extends to providing top-tier training for scientists, recognizing that the combination of cutting-edge technology and expert training is essential for achieving optimal outcomes. Trust is paramount in the industry, as manufacturers entrust the facility with their products, often before they reach the market. The facility has significantly expanded its footprint in just eight years since obtaining GLP certification, tripling its size. Plans are underway to further increase laboratory space by 50-60 percent in the coming year, adding 70,000-80,000 square feet. Alongside this expansion, staff numbers are expected to grow by 30-40 percent, ensuring that the facility can continue to meet the evolving needs of its clients with the highest standards of quality and reliability.
